BDNF — MMP9

Text-mined interactions from Literome

Taishi et al., Am J Physiol Regul Integr Comp Physiol 2001 (Sleep Deprivation) : mRNA expression of four molecules [brain derived neurotrophic factor ( BDNF ), activity regulated cytoskeleton associated protein ( Arc ), matrix metalloproteinase-9 (MMP-9) , and tissue plasminogen activator (tPA) ] was determined after 8 h of sleep deprivation and after 6 h of a mild increase in ambient temperature, a condition that enhances sleep in rats
Sartor et al., Clin Exp Metastasis 2002 (Brain Neoplasms...) : At the membrane level, gelatinase MMP-2 -- mainly the activated form -- was restrained by CNTF and BDNF to a residual 34 % with both factors ; membrane-type 1 MMP was down-regulated to 50 % ( 10 h ) and 34 % ( 24 h ) with both factors ; and urokinase-type plasminogen activator was restrained mainly by BDNF to 70 %
Sun et al., Chin Med J (Engl) 2006 : The stimulation of serum starved HUVECs with BDNF caused obvious increase in MMP-2 and MMP-9 mRNA expression and induced the pro-MMP-2 and pro-MMP-9 activation without significant differences in proliferation
Dagnell et al., Translational research : the journal of laboratory and clinical medicine 2007 : Therefore, we studied the effect of NGF, BDNF , and NT-3 on human bronchial smooth muscle cell ( HBSMC ) migration and MMP-2 and MMP-9 secretion ... BDNF , NT-3, and NGF increased MMP-9 , but not MMP-2, secretion as shown by zymography
Zhang et al., Zhonghua Xue Ye Xue Za Zhi 2008 (Multiple Myeloma) : The BDNF induced activation of MMP-9 was inhibited by pretreatment with pyrrolidine dithiocarbamate ( PDTC ), a NF-kappaB inhibitor, or K252 alpha, a specific tyrosine inhibitor of TrkB which is the receptor for BDNF
Kuzniewska et al., Mol Cell Biol 2013 : The BDNF induced MMP-9 transcription was dependent on extracellular signal regulated kinase 1/2 ( ERK1/2 ) pathway and c-Fos expression ... Overexpression of AP-1 dimers in neurons led to MMP-9 promoter activation, with the most potent being those that contained c-Fos, whereas knockdown of endogenous c-Fos by small hairpin RNA ( shRNA ) reduced BDNF mediated MMP-9 transcription ... BDNF stimulation of neurons induced binding of endogenous c-Fos to the proximal MMP-9 promoter region
